I recently bought the Milwaukee M18 Fuel mower after a lot of consideration, especially since it cost around $1,000. I was expecting a great experience based on all the positive reviews. However, I've faced some major issues. The mower only works for about 20 minutes on a full charge, struggles to start (I cleaned out the blades yet still need to attempt starting multiple times), and the batteries were already opened when I received the box. When I contacted Milwaukee's customer service, they told me I'd need to send it in for repairs, leaving me without a mower for an indefinite time, and I've only had it for two days. Is this the level of customer service and quality that everyone praises? Am I just unlucky, or is there a bigger issue at play here?

I know it’s frustrating, but consider how much you were trying to cut. Wet grass can drain batteries fast, plus I’ve seen people get used batteries swapped in at stores. Could be that someone returned a damaged product without checking first.

Sounds like you might’ve gotten a defective unit or even a tampered one. If the batteries were opened, they could have been swapped. It’s pretty unusual for a new mower to have such problems right away. Definitely take it back and get a new one if you can.
